oracle資料庫知識點整理

2021-07-10 01:15:21 字數 750 閱讀 5265

1、行列轉換

2、一條sql語句取出整個樹形結構

pid = 0 是根節點的資料,id 主鍵,pid父id;

select * from rc_area start with pid = 0 connect by prior id = pid

3、number(p, s):有效數字和精度

number(p,s)

p: 1---38 如果為指定,預設38

s: -84---127

a、s > 0 (精確到小數點右邊 s 位,並四捨五入 。然後檢驗有效數字是否 <= p)

例如:number(5,2) 有效數字最多是5位,保留小數點後2位;

123.45  --  123.45

123     --  123.00

1.2356  --  1.24

0.001   --  0.00

b、s < 0 (精確到小數點左邊 s 位,並四捨五入 。然後檢驗有效數字是否 <= p + |s|)

例如:number(5,-2) 小數點左邊最後2位四捨五入,最多7位有效數字

123456        --  123460

1234567.6789  --  1234600

1             --  0    

總結:在 p < s 這種情況下 只能用來存放大於0小於1的小數。

在 p > s 這種情況下 小數點前最多只能插入:p - s個數字,但小數點後的數字可以是任意長度(儲存時會四捨五入)

資料庫知識點整理

一 資料庫三正規化 第一正規化 確保每列保持原子性 即所有字段值都是不可分解的原子值。需要根據實際情況劃分,比如 位址 可以當作,如果經常關注位址中的城市部分,就要把位址拆成省份,城市,詳細位址多個字段。列不能再分 第二正規化 確保表中的每列都和主鍵相關 即需要確保資料庫表中每一列都和主鍵相關,而不...

MSE複試 資料庫知識點整理

第二章 關係模型的基本概念與基本理論 2.1 資料庫的基本概念 資料庫,資料庫管理系統 dbms database management system 資料模型 data model 2.2 關係模型的基本概念 資料結構 二維表 table relation 屬性 column attribute ...

資料庫SQL面試知識點整理

一 什麼是儲存過程?有哪些優缺點?儲存過程是一些預編譯的sql語句。更加直白的理解 儲存過程可以說是乙個記錄集,它是由一些t sql語句組成的 塊,這些t sql語句 像乙個方法一樣實現一些功能 對單錶或多表的增刪改查 然後再給這個 塊取乙個名字,在用到這個功能的時候呼叫他就行了。儲存過程是乙個預編...